Sql updating identity column 100procent free sexdate
If you want to use a "Generated Always Identity" column as your primary key, then you will have to specify that explicitly.I have connected my web application to a SQL Server 2012.He has authored 11 SQL Server database books, 23 Pluralsight courses and has written over 4700 articles on the database technology on his blog at a https://blog.Along with 16 years of hands on experience he holds a Masters of Science degree and a number of database certifications.The second part shows that you can insert into the table, as long as the identity column isn't used in the insert statement. declare 2 r t%rowtype; 3 begin 4 := 42; 5 := 'world'; 6 insert into t values r; 7 end; 8 / declare * ERROR at line 1: ORA-32795: cannot insert into a generated always identity column ORA-06512: at line 6 In short: updating a "Generated Always Identity" column is not allowed either.One final remark: an identity column is not the same as a primary key.For any SQL Server Performance Tuning Issue send an email at [email protected]
In the first section the table is created with a "Generated Always Identity" column.If I use the "Generate Script" feature of SSMS, the script would attempt to insert using the same ID, which would conflict existing data in the destination database. I want the identity column at the destination to continue normally from its last value. Item Id); --== ** END ACTUAL ANSWER ** ==-- --== Display the results ==-- SELECT * FROM Customers2 JOIN Orders2 ON Orders2. It's not for the faint of heart, and times) in a test environment.Here's a way that scales easily to three related tables. Id; SELECT * FROM Customers2 JOIN Orders2 ON Orders2. UPDATE: I should also say that, even with this, I didn't worry overmuch about "wasting" ID values.SET NOCOUNT ON; -- Insert statements for procedure here INSERT INTO Personal Details (First Name, Last Name, Age, Active) VALUES (@First Name, @Last Name, @Age, @Active) method.When we execute this stored procedure, after inserting the record, it returns the Personal Detials Id value of last inserted record.
When you sign in to comment, IBM will provide your email, first name and last name to DISQUS.